What you'll do



Assist client with daily living activities, including personal hygiene, dressing, and meal preparation Support with medication and daily routines Help client build skills, confidence, and independence Be a friendly face, a listening ear, and a trusted presence, supporting emotional wellbeing Foster strong relationships with the client through effective communication Maintain accurate records of client progress and any changes in condition Drive client to appointments or social activities as required, ensuring their safety during travel. Help maintain a clean and safe environment within the client's home. Engage client in social activities to promote mental well-being and companionship.

Requirements



Previous experience with Learning Disability, Autism and Mental Health conditions preferable. Strong communication skills in English, both verbal and written. Basic IT skills for record keeping and communication purposes. A valid driving licence is essential for roles involving transportation of clients. Ability to follow care plans accurately and adapt to the needs of individual clients. A caring attitude with a commitment to providing high-quality support to those in need.
